Answer to Question 1

Two of the most well known federal statutes are the Electronic Communications Privacy Act (ECPA) and the Privacy Protection Act (PPA).
The ECPA was essentially the modernization of the then obsolete wiretapping statute. The original code was written to protect the privacy of telephone conversations and simply did not cover the emerging technologies involved with Internet communications. Thus, the ECPA was born to codify when government could and could not intercept Internet and/or stored electronic communications (i.e. residing on a server). Another federal law, The Privacy Protection Act (PPA) also had many purposes, but the most applicable was the protection of certain materials from government seizure. The PPA arose because of perceptions that in seizing evidence, government entities were seizing materials that were not evidence and were not directly related to their particular criminal investigations.
